MTP 034xLaboratory Tests and Diagnostic Procedures in Liver Disease: Adventures in Liver LandClinical questions to be addressed:Discuss the significance of elevations of serum AST, ALT alkaline phosphatase and bilirubin levels.Elucidate the utility and limitations of ultrasound, CT, HIDA scan, MRI, and MRCP in evaluating hepatobiliary disease.Discuss the salient aspects of selected liver disorders such as alcoholic hepatitis, idiopathic genetic hemochromatosis, PBC, autoimmune hepatitis, non-alcoholic steatohepatitis (NASH) and Wilson's disease.Discuss the emerging role of non-invasive tests such as fibrosure and fibroscan as alternatives to liver biopsy.
